Here are some basic tips for all vehicle owners and users during rainy season since the roads are wet and slippery which is not ideal for cruisin'.
- Take it easy. Drive slowly when the roads are wet. Rushing may result in an accidents.
- Avoid puddles. Drive around a puddle, not into it; it may be deeper than you think.
- Break earlier. This way, there's more space between you and the car in-front of you. Plus, it helps other drivers know you're slowing down.
- Use your signal lights. Never switch lanes or turn without using your signal lights so that drivers behind you can adjust.
- Pull over. If you can hardly see the road or the cars in front of you, pull over to a safe place with your hazard lights on.
- Move away from big vehicles. The large tires of buses or trucks can spray water on your windshield and block your vision.
